Algebraic specification of communication protocols by S. Mauw, G. J. Veltink

By S. Mauw, G. J. Veltink
Smooth laptop networks now circle the area, however the transmission of data between them is determined by the various assorted protocols that outline the habit of the sender and receiver. it's transparent hence, that the exact description of those protocols is critical if harmonious communique is to be maintained. during this booklet the authors use the formal specification language PSF to supply an unambiguous description of numerous verbal exchange protocols of various degrees of complexity, starting from the alternating bit protocol to the token ring protocol. rookies, in addition to pros within the box of communique protocols, will take advantage of either the equipment of specification defined, and the protocols mentioned during this booklet.
Read or Download Algebraic specification of communication protocols PDF
Similar programming languages books
TCP/IP Tutorial and Technical Overview
The TCP/IP protocol suite has turn into the de facto general for desktop communications in state-of-the-art networked international. the ever present implementation of a particular networking general has ended in a major dependence at the purposes enabled by way of it. this day, we use the TCP/IP protocols and the net not just for leisure and data, yet to behavior our enterprise by means of acting transactions, trading items, and supplying providers to buyers.
Sams teach yourself Cobol in 24 hours
Sams train your self COBOL in 24 Hours teaches the fundamentals of COBOL programming in 24 step by step classes. each one lesson builds at the past one offering a high-quality origin in COBOL programming ideas and strategies. Coupled with the resource code and the compiler on hand from Fujitsu, this hands-on consultant is the simplest, quickest approach to commence developing normal COBOL compliant code.
CMMI® for improvement (CMMI-DEV) describes most sensible practices for the advance and upkeep of goods and prone throughout their lifecycle. by means of integrating crucial our bodies of data, CMMI-DEV presents a unmarried, complete framework for enterprises to evaluate their improvement and upkeep techniques and increase functionality.
Extra resources for Algebraic specification of communication protocols
Sample text
15, no. 4, pp. 65–66, July/Aug. 687947. 18 PART ONE ABOUT CMMI FOR DEVELOPMENT for one area of interest was sometimes extended to all three. , team composition, empowerment, and operational discipline); and alignment of high maturity practices with business objectives enabled by analytics. 3 user may be unaware of these synergies or their sources, but may derive benefit from them. 3, we’ve only begun to explore ideas for the future of CMMI. 3, there are lots of promising directions forward, which is only the case because of Roger’s original pioneering vision for CMMI.
Shaw Thinking Empirically Thinking empirically about software engineering changes the way you think about process improvement. Software engineering is an engineering discipline. Like other disciplines, software engineering requires an empirical paradigm that involves observing, building models, analyzing, and experimenting so that we can learn. We need to model the products, the processes, and the cause/effect relationships between them in the context of the organization and the project set. This empirical mindset provides a basis for choosing the appropriate processes, analyzing the effects of those selections, and packaging the resulting knowledge for reuse and evolution; it drives an effective process improvement initiative.
I began to think of them as the stars of process improvement. I pushed this metaphor a little further to call the collection of components that would be useful in building a model, its training materials, and appraisal documents for an area of interest a constellation. This was the beginning of the architecture that was eventually created. Chapter 1 Introduction 15 There are two primary objectives for the CMMI Framework architecture: • Enable the coverage of selected areas of interest to make useful and effective processes.